I'm guessing Chris Christie has pretty much figured out that he isn't going to be president:

New Jersey Gov. Chris Christie (R) gave a speech on Wednesday full of vulgarities directed at reporters over the George Washington Bridge scandal, New Jersey's finances, and his travel history.

"We don't give a s--- about this or any of you," Christie told a crowd of 350 people at the Hamilton banquet hall on Wednesday, according to Bloomberg Politics. The event was an annual event in New Jersey which features a roast of the sitting New Jersey governor. Elected officials, journalists, and lobbyists attend the event.

The New Jersey governor said one journalist should "open your eyes" and "clean the s--- out of your ears."

"This is a guy who says he doesn't know what I'm doing every day," Christie said of another journalist according to the Bloomberg report. "Then just get the f--- away from me if you don't know what I'm doing."

Bloomberg obtained audio of Christie's remarks. Christie spokesman Kevin Roberts said that Christie's comments were just jokes and made under the premise that they would not be published.

I know right wingers love bullies and hate the press. But when you're running for president you really can't go around saying stuff like "Get the fuck away from me" and "clean the shit out of your ears" in public. (Can you?)

And when are these idiots going to understand that everyone has recording devices at all times? There's no "off the record" in any speech you give to a group. One would have thought that was obvious even before everyone had recording devices.
